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02738369 9661033 51142 58288126687 2482855
37781458904 0064233 82
37781458904 0064233 82
0579 3228847269 296599482 0603343869
All about undefined
Interested in learning more?
37781458904 0064233 82
0579 3228847269 296599482 0603343869
See more
86420183 631906 366
65 52525 1817483
See more
391407 71
276956618 802 4078
See more